Fertilization and weed control in Universal City means working against thin clay and bedrock that sits just below the surface, especially in neighborhoods like Forest Crest and Northview. That shallow soil drains fast and holds nutrients poorly, which is exactly why a soil-matched feeding program matters here. Without it, your lawn stays thin and weeds move in.

Military families and established homeowners around Randolph AFB know that a healthy lawn takes steady attention in our part of Bexar County. The clay-heavy ground around Universal City needs the right fertilizer blend and smart timing on pre- and post-emergent weed control to actually work. How many times a year should a lawn be fertilized in Texas?

Most Central Texas lawns benefit from fertilization about 3 to 4 times a year, timed to the growing season, paired with pre- and post-emergent weed control. A consistent program keeps turf thick, green and naturally crowds out weeds.

When should I apply pre-emergent weed control?

Apply pre-emergent in early spring (around February) to stop summer weeds, and again in early fall to stop cool-season weeds, before they germinate. Timing is everything, which is why a scheduled program works far better than spot-treating weeds after they appear.

Why does fertilization have to be different in Universal City than other parts of San Antonio?

The clay-over-bedrock makeup near Randolph AFB drains fast and doesn't hold nutrients the way deeper, loamier soil does. We tailor blend and timing to what that thin soil actually supports, not a one-size program. That means your lawn gets what it can actually use instead of wasted runoff.

Should I use pre-emergent or post-emergent weed control?

Both. Pre-emergent stops seeds before they sprout, usually early spring and fall in our area. Post-emergent tackles what's already there. We schedule both into your annual program so you're hitting weeds at their weakest and protecting the lawn before they take hold in Universal City's heat.

How often does my Universal City lawn need fertilizer?

Most Universal City lawns need feeding 3 to 4 times a year, timed to what grows here and when. Spring green-up, early summer strength, fall recovery, and sometimes winter dormancy prep. We adjust based on soil test results and how your lawn responds to our August and September heat.

How long before I see a thicker, greener lawn after we start?

You'll see better color and density within 4 to 6 weeks if the lawn was already decent; rebuilding thin lawns takes a full season or two. Consistent feeding and weed control compound over time. By next spring, a lawn that started thin over our clay bedrock should be visibly thicker and hold fewer weeds.
